STARS Air Ambulance landed in a rural area southeast of Penhold yesterday afternoon (Aug 22nd) following a crash between a grain truck and vehicle. 

It happened shortly after 5, east of the QE2, at range road 262 and township road 362. 

Innisfail RCMP say a grain truck was exiting a driveway and was hit by an oncoming pick-up truck. 

The 67 year old man driving the grain truck was airlifted in serious but stable condition to the Foothills in Calgary. 

The 16 year old driver of the pick-up sustained minor injuries and was treated at the scene.
